Subject: RE: protocols to bind to
I agree with SOAP, ebXML and XMLP. I also share your hesitation with http and smtp. The first three XML transports can or will be able to bind to HTTP, SMTP, BEEP, etc, so there might be a lot of reinventing that will occur to bind to those lower layers. The WSDL 1.1 spec provides the following bindings: SOAP 1.1, HTTP GET, HTTP POST, and MIME. I believe MIME falls into the same category as http and smtp, where the higher layer xml transports will provide bindings to it (as is the case for SOAP + Attachments.)
